The Mahindra 4110 is a compact utility tractor produced from 2002 to 2009 by Mahindra and built by TYM in South Korea. It features a 2.0L 4-cylinder liquid-cooled diesel engine producing 41 hp, with a 12-speed synchomesh shuttle transmission. The tractor offers four-wheel drive, hydrostatic power steering, and wet disc brakes. It has an independent electro-hydraulic PTO with 540/1000 RPM options. The 4110 has a rear lift capacity of 2865 lbs and uses 9.5-16 front and 14.9-24 rear agricultural tires. Electrical system includes a 12-volt battery and 50 amp alternator. Attachments include the ML112 front-end loader with a lift capacity of 1972 lbs and breakout force of 3343 lbs. The tractor is part of Mahindra's 10 Series compact utility tractors.
